HTML5+CSS3设计电子书难吗? 网页设计知识能用上吗?

HTML5+CSS3设计电子书难吗?各位捧着电子书,翻阅文字的同(Tong)志(Zhi)们,大家好!听说最近不少人想用HTML5和CSS3来制作电子书,可是又怕这个工程浩大。作为一名在网页设计界摸爬滚打的(三流)小编,今天我就来跟大家聊聊这个话题。网页设计知识能用上吗?当然!HTML5和CSS3都是网页设计的前沿技术,不少知识是可以直接运用到电子书制作中的。以下表格总结了部分可以复用的知识点: 网

HTML5+CSS3设计电子书难吗?

各位捧着电子书,翻阅文字的同(Tong)志(Zhi)们,大家好!听说最近不少人想用HTML5和CSS3来制作电子书,可是又怕这个工程浩大。作为一名在网页设计界摸爬滚打的(三流)小编,今天我就来跟大家聊聊这个话题。

网页设计知识能用上吗?

当然!HTML5和CSS3都是网页设计的前沿技术,不少知识是可以直接运用到电子书制作中的。以下表格总结了部分可以复用的知识点:

网页设计知识 电子书应用
HTML5语义化标签 结构化电子书内容
CSS3样式规则 控制电子书外观和布局
响应式设计 适应不同屏幕尺寸
多媒体支持 添加图片、视频、音频
交互性 翻页、笔记、书签等功能

电子书与网页的差异

虽然HTML5+CSS3可以应用于电子书制作,但二者之间还是存在一些差异:

1. 媒介不同

网页通常在屏幕上阅读,而电子书更像是纸质书的电子版本。在设计电子书时,需要考虑翻页、字体大小、间距等因素。

2. 内容排布

网页往往采用单列布局,而电子书则可以采用双列或多列布局,以更好地适应较小的屏幕。电子书内容需要进行分页处理。

3. 交互性需求

网页强调交互性,有各种点击、跳转、动画效果。而电子书的交互性较弱,主要集中在翻页、书签、笔记等功能上。

4. 阅读体验

网页追求沉浸式体验,而电子书更注重清晰、舒适的阅读效果。电子书设计应避免杂乱的背景和不必要的动画。

HTML5+CSS3设计电子书的技巧

掌握了差异性,再结合网页设计知识,就可以着手设计电子书了。以下是一些技巧:

1. 选择合适的模板

市面上有不少现成的HTML5+CSS3电子书模板,可以节省大量时间和精力。但要根据电子书的内容和风格选择最合适的模板。

2. 注重内容结构

电子书的内容应该用语义化标签组织好,如章节标题使用H1-H6标签,段落使用P标签,列表使用UL/OL标签等。

3. 合理运用CSS样式

运用CSS样式可以控制电子书的字体、颜色、间距等,但要注意避免使用过于花哨的样式,以免影响阅读体验。

4. 添加交互功能

电子书可以添加翻页、书签、笔记等交互功能,提高阅读舒适度。

5. 优化阅读体验

做好对齐、排版,选择合适的字体和字号,调整行距和段间距,确保电子书页面布局舒朗、易读。

谁适合用HTML5+CSS3制作电子书?

如果你是以上三种人群中的任意一种,那么使用HTML5+CSS3制作电子书将是一个不错的选择:

1. Web开发者

熟悉HTML5+CSS3,可以快速上手电子书制作。

2. 作家或撰稿人

有专业的写作技能,想要自主出版自己的作品。

3. 设计师

有设计基础,希望将自己的作品制作成电子书形式。

总结

HTML5+CSS3设计电子书并非难事,只要掌握一定的技巧和知识,就能制作出美观、实用的电子书。希望这篇文章能帮助到各位电子书设计爱好者。

互动

你对HTML5+CSS3设计电子书还有什么疑问吗?

你认为网页设计知识在电子书制作中有哪些应用?

分享一下你自己的电子书设计经验或心得吧!